I decided to clear out some older mods I had on Steam Workshop but afterwards my game CTD'd when trying to load in, so I reinstalled them but the same issue occurs. It still says the same "Save Relies on Missing Content" prompt before loading in but I have reinstalled everything that was there before. I have already used LOOT to sort out my load order but unfortunately the problem persists. The mods in question are:


Fur Hoods HD, New Bard Songs, Item Sorting by Dasaige, House Map Markers by Smakit, Faster Vanilla Horses, and Sounds of Skyrim(all three).


Any advice on correcting my silly mistake would be greatly appreciated.

if it says your save relies on missing content , this means you have at least one plugin missing

this could be due to a plugin having their name changed , or you not reinstalling one of the mods

 

you need to find the missing plugin (I believe you can see which plugins are loaded in a save , but not really sure which tool does that . try finding it on google) , and add it to the game

this should hopefully fix the issue

 

as a side note , never remove mods from an existing save , unless you absolutely know what you are doing

it would usually lead to your save breaking , and it's just not worth it

I found the tool, Skyrim Savegame Scanner. I dug through the plugins and found the issue, it was a mod that I didn't even remember I got rid of, must've been a misclick when I first tried uninstaling mods. I reinstalled it, sorted my load order, and everything is working good now. Thank you for the advice.
